Easy Approaches to Convert Quality Improvement to Research

Wednesday, October 24, 2012

“No hospital too small; no study too big”

With the approaches described in this seminar, it becomes clear that for the clinician, there is no hospital too small for conducting improvement research; and for the scientist, there is no research question too big that can’t be answered and supported through a research network. Today, multi-site network studies are a necessity to generate evidence for healthcare improvement and patient safety. But how well do they work? Join the ISRN for a discussion on easing the transition of a project from quality improvement to research.
